lee, one of the reasons i have migrated almost exclusively to stars is because of the customer service. i dont have to tell you that youre by far the best in the biz. your presence on the boards here has always been reassuring and im glad you replied.

id like to bring up a few points. whether you address them in this email or not is up to you.

1. We're improving our tools for better reliability. We learned some specific things from Teddy's mom's situation. A couple of things that used to send up a big red flag that says "BOT!" now send up a small yellow pennant that says "um, bot?"


one major point that jeff continually brought up in email was the 46 or 36 or whatever hours that were played under the account. it seems as if there was a software glitch or human error in this case rather than a simple "yellow flag" turning into a "red flag."


2. We are improving peer review and escalation procedures. Obviously, we still have to catch the real bots, but we want to reduce the false positives. And if we do get an initial false positive, we have a review process that will keep it from going too far before it gets caught.


the is one of the more important things to me. i was deeply alarmed to read the emails where jeff stated that he was the end-all-be-all voice of bot accusation at stars and there would be no further discussion at the company. i am greatly relieved to hear measures are in place for some checks and balances.

in the past ive trusted stars reputation and i trust this was a major oversight on procedure that will be corrected. thank you for replying to this thread.
